Understanding Index Funds

Before we delve into specific techniques, it’s crucial that we establish a clear understanding of index funds. Simply put, index funds are investment vehicles designed to mirror the performance of a specific index, such as the S&P 500. By holding a diversified collection of stocks or bonds within a particular index, these funds allow us to invest in market performance without the need for active management.

The appeal of index funds lies in their simplicity, lower costs, and potential for solid returns. They provide a straightforward pathway to wealth building, making them ideal for serious long-term investors like us who want to eliminate the noise of stock picking and market speculation.

1. Embrace Dollar-Cost Averaging

One of the most effective strategies for investing in index funds is dollar-cost averaging (DCA). This method involves consistently invest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of the market conditions.

Why DCA Works

The key advantage of DCA is that it mitigates the impact of volatility in the market. By purchasing consistently over time, our average cost per share can decrease, particularly when markets are down. Consequently, when the market rebounds, we benefit from the rise while having acquired shares at a lower average cost.

4. Maintain a Long-Term Perspective

Investing with a long-term perspective is essential. We must recognize that short-term market fluctuations are commonplace and that maintaining our focus on long-term goals can lead to significant wealth accumulation over time.

Why Perspective Matters

Historically, markets have shown upward trends over extended periods, and by staying invested, we harness the power of compounding. Reacting to short-term volatility often results in mistakes—either selling in panic or missing out on gains.

5. Regularly Rebalance Our Portfolio

Rebalancing our investment portfolio is a fundamental practice that can help us maintain our desired asset allocation and align with our investment strategy.

The Purpose of Rebalancing

As we invest and markets fluctuate, our portfolio’s asset allocation can drift from its target. For instance, if our stocks perform exceptionally well, they may constitute a larger percentage of our portfolio, increasing our risk exposure.
